Jalen Green missed all three regular-season meetings between the Phoenix Suns and Golden State Warriors. He made up for it Friday.Green scored 36 points — including 13 in the third quarter — to lead the Suns past the Warriors, 111-96, in a Play-In Tournament elimination game in Phoenix.After blowing an 11-point fourth-quarter lead in Thursday’s 7-8 matchup, the Suns didn’t let this one slip. They held off the Warriors to secure the No. 8 seed in the Western Conference and a first-round matchup with the top-seeded Oklahoma City Thunder.Advertisement
